Lieut David Hale Accountants Office
Corps of Art E. March 30th 1797
West Point — Sir
I received your letter of the 27th Instant enclosing another for Mr Fleming; but previous to that event he had left Town for West Point; I therefore according to your request return you your letter to him enclosed herewith. I am &c.
Wm Simmons
Acct.
The Hon. Sec of War Accountants Office
Sir March 30th 1797
In conformity to the request contained in your letter of yesterday I have the honour of transmitting to you the account of the number of Clerks employed in my Office from 1st January to 31st March 1797 and their Salaries, which are at the same rate [above line: were paid] [strikethrough: that they received] the last Quarter. I am &c.
Wm Simmons
Acct.
Capt William MacRea Accountants Office
Alexandria March 30th 1797
Sir
I received your letter of the 20th instant & have in answer thereto to inform you that on a reference to your account on the Books of this Office I find you stand charged with monies received in the year 1792 and early part of 1793 on account of your pay, one months pay of a detachment, and for Contingencies of marching it to Pittsburgh. It will therefore be necessary for you to account for those monies before payment
